What Is A Tonneau Cover Made Of?
Tonneau covers come in two main material types:
Hard Tonneau Covers
Hard tonneau covers are made from materials like aluminum, fiberglass, or polymer plastic. They provide sturdy, rigid protection for the truck bed. Popular brands of hard folding tonneau covers include BAKFlip, Retrax, UnderCover, Extang, and GatorCover.
Soft Tonneau Covers
Soft tonneau covers are made from vinyl, canvas, or other fabric materials. They roll or fold up for versatile cargo access. Leading soft roll up tonneau brands include Access, TruXedo, Extang, and Tyger Auto.
Vinyl is a common material used in many soft tonneau cover designs. It is durable, water-resistant, and provides good UV protection.
Purpose Of A Vinyl Protectant Spray
A vinyl protectant spray is formulated to keep vinyl, rubber, and plastic surfaces looking clean and protected. Key benefits of vinyl protectant include:
- Restores luster – Makes vinyl look darker and like new again.
- Prevents fading – Blocks UV rays to prevent sun damage and fading.
- Repels water – Causes water to bead up and roll off instead of soaking in.
- Inhibits dirt buildup – Leaves a protective coating that makes dirt less likely to stick.
- Conditions material – Softens and moisturizes to keep vinyl supple.
Using a protectant spray 1-2 times per year can maintain the appearance and extend the lifespan of a vinyl tonneau cover.
Is It Safe For Tonneau Covers? What To Look For.
The main question is whether vinyl protectant sprays are safe to use on tonneau covers or if they may cause damage over time. Here are some tips:
1. Check Manufacturer Guidelines
The tonneau cover owner’s manual or manufacturer website will often provide care recommendations. Follow their guidance for approved cleaners and protectants to use. Using non-approved chemicals often voids the warranty.
2. Choose A Tonneau-Safe Formula
Some vinyl protectants contain ingredients like silicon or alcohol that can prematurely break down vinyl tonneau covers. Opt for a gentler formula designed specifically for tonneau covers.
3. Spot Test First
Apply a small amount in a hidden area and let it dry completely. Check for any adverse effects like discoloration, streaking, cracking, or changes to texture. If all looks normal, it should be safe to use overall.
4. Avoid Overapplication
Use only a thin layer of protectant. Over-saturation can damage vinyl over time and leave a greasy buildup that attracts dirt. Wipe off any excess liquid.
5. Consider Less Frequent Use
For added precaution, limit applications to just once or twice per year instead of monthly. This reduces long-term chemical exposure.
Using these tips helps ensure vinyl protectant spray will safely clean, condition, and renew a vinyl tonneau cover rather than harm it. Check that the product is specifically designed for tonneau covers.

How To Clean A Tonneau Cover
Regular cleaning is the first step in caring for a vinyl tonneau cover. Here is a simple cleaning process:
Supplies Needed
- Tonneau cover foaming cleanser
- Soft brush and microfiber cloths
- Hose with pressurized water stream
Cleaning Steps
- Use the foaming cleanser and soft brush to loosen dirt on both the top and bottom surfaces of the vinyl cover. Avoid harsh scrubbing.
- For hard to reach spots, spray cleanser and let it soak briefly before brushing.
- Rinse thoroughly with clean water using moderate pressure to blast away all suds and grime.
- Allow the cover to air dry completely before using any vinyl protectants.
- Wipe down with protectant and microfiber cloth. Use sparingly and buff away excess.
- For periodic deep cleaning, repeat the wash process before reapplying the protectant.
Proper cleaning is key before attempting to use any vinyl conditioners or protectants. It removes dirt, dust, and buildup that can make the cover look dull.
How Often To Use A Vinyl Protectant
When it comes to frequency of use, less is often more with vinyl tonneau protectants. Here are some general guidelines:
- For soft vinyl covers, use every 3-6 months
- For hard covers, use 1-2 times per year
- In harsh environments with intense sun, dirt, and weathering, protect every 2-3 months
- In cooler climates, yearly application may suffice
- Avoid overusing. 1-2 times per year is often adequate.
Assess the cover condition and climate factors. More frequent cleaning may be needed, but limit protectant use to avoid buildup. Follow manufacturer guidance on reapplication intervals.
